Volleyball Results: Aug. 19
NORTHWOOD 3, BETHANY CHRISTIAN 0
Life just got better for NorthWood the longer it played Bethany Christian Monday night. In its season opener at a well attended AC building, the Panthers got stronger as the night went on in a 25-20, 25-13, 25-6 win over the Bruins.
Maddy Payne picked up where she left off after a strong summer club season. The senior middle had 10 kills, four blocks and three aces in a full night of work. Caroline Mullet, who played with Payne in the US Nationals in July, hung 22 assists along with 10 digs and six kills. Kennedy Hochstetler added 12 digs and three aces, and Gracie Clark tossed in 10 digs in the win.
The NorthWood junior varsity started its season off right, beating Bethany 25-20, 25-18 to open its season.
JOHN GLENN 3, TRITON 0
Triton couldn’t quite catch Glenn in its season opener, losing 25-13, 25-21, 25-20 in Walkerton.
The Viers sisters, Alyxa and Abbey, combined for 13 kills while the duo of Molly McFarland and Jaela Faulkner combined for 37 digs. Faulkner added three aces, and the combo of Dylanie Miller and Emma Hepler had 20 total assists for the Trojans.
Triton (0-1) visit Mishawaka Wednesday evening.
